The invention relates to ship model waterline measurement and calibration equipment and method, and the equipment comprises calibration devices which are detachably connected with a side board of a ship model, at least two calibration devices are arranged on the side board in the length direction of any side board, and each calibration device comprises a horizontal measurement instrument which is used for monitoring the inclination angle of the position where the horizontal measurement instrument is located; the water level measuring instrument is used for monitoring the distance between the position and the water surface; the calculation module is used for calculating the distance between the water surface and the waterline and defining the distance as a calibration distance, each calibration device is in communication connection with a display device, and the display device displays the inclination angle and the calibration distance measured by each calibration device in real time. A plurality of sets of waterline measurement and calibration equipment are configured to monitor each part of a waterline, monitor whether the waterline is horizontal or not, monitor the distance between the water level and the waterline at the same time, and transmit inclination angle data measured by each calibration device and the calibration distance to display equipment for real-time display, so that high-precision leveling of ship model draft can be conveniently and accurately carried out.
